punta ka sa sunlife office then inquire ka na lang dun about mutual funds. if they try to sell insurance (and they will, mas malaki kasi ang commission nila sa insurance ) don't be shy to tell them right off that you went there for the mutual funds and not insurance.

check mo muna website nila, specifically the link to /product/mutual funds
then see mo dun the different investments you can put your money into, like equities, bonds, balanced funds, etc. study each one thoroughly before you go to the sunlife office so you will know exactly what you want, and so you don't allow yourself to be "sales talked".
i also suggest to complete the investor profile page >>> http://www.sunlife.com.ph/mutualfunds/kyc.asp
there are also other mutual fund companies out there besides sunlife that you should consider. in fact the better performing ones are Philam mutual and another not so well known company. i plan to invest in Philam sometime also. the only thing you need to remember is better performance = more risks.

Yep, me large format printer ako dun, pero usually pang banners lang usage ko, nagloloko nga kasi China yung printer ko, kaya wag kayo kukuha ng China. Yung vehicle wraps, mukhang di ko na kayang gawin kasi wala na ko time mag market sa mga corporate, but I seriously believe na puede sya mauso. Meron na ko nakikita mangilanngilan na mga delivery trucks at buses, MRT, pero me market pa to para sa mga medium sized companies, at tsaka yung mga car-mods din. Of course pag me wide format printer ka, di lang naman vehicle wraps puede mo gawin. Banners, stickers, posters, even the small labels of mineral water bottles you can do. Pero itong vehicle wraps talaga ang sa tingin ko eh wala pang nag specialize masyado.
Yung 30" printer/cutter machine, puede na kung me 800T ka. Yung 54" mas malapad, mga 1.1M siguro budget mo dun.
